Abstract
Orthodontic systems for monitoring treatment. The systems can include at least one orthodontic appliance that includes one or more sensors. A processor in communication with the sensor(s) is configured to receive sensor data from the sensor(s), where the sensor data corresponds to a force acting on one or more teeth. The processor is further configured to predict tooth movement based on the sensor data. The predicted tooth movement is determined by predicting how much teeth will move based on a direction and a magnitude of the force. The processor is further configured to compare the predicted tooth movement to an expected tooth movement, where the expected tooth movement is based on a treatment stage of a treatment plan. The processor is further configured to modify the treatment plan if the predicted tooth movement does not match the expected tooth movement based on the treatment stage of the treatment plan.
